Trochanteric Fixation Nail- Advanced System-11MM/130 DEG TI CANN TFNA 420MM/Right Sterile (The TFN-ADVANCED Proximal Femoral Nailing System) The TFN-ADVANCED Proximal Femoral Nailing System is intended for treatment of fractures. Intramedullary fixation rod, orthopedic.

Official wording

Reason: TFNA nails may have the locking mechanism too close to the top of the nail. This may 1. Prevent the cannulated connecting screw from fully tightening the insertion handle to the nail resulting in a loose or toggling nail in the handle. Or 2. Cause the bottom of the cannulated connecting screw to tighten against the top of the locking mechanism preventing advancement of the locking mechanism.

Code information: Part Number Lot Number 04.037.162S 7950511

Distribution pattern: US Distribution to states of: CA, FL, MI and WI.
